1960 Deaths and Funerals Cowpens, June 28- BROADUS CASH, 68, died in a Columbia hospital following several years of declining health. MR. CASH was a member of Mount Olive Baptist church for the past 55 years. His wife, MRS. EMMA McCLURE CASH, died about 25 years ago. He was the s/o MR. and MRS. JEFF CASH. Surviving are one sister, MRS. J.D. LITTLEJOHN, Converse; 2 brothers, JOHNNY and J.M. CASH, Chesnee; 3 half-brothers, ANDY and EDGAR GARDNER, Chesnee and CLAYTON GARDNER, Brevard, N.C. Johnson Mortuary in charge. ----- Pacolet Mills- MRS. HANNAH McCRAVY PUCKETT, 80, died at the General hospital after an illness of 5 weeks. She was born in Sptbg. Co., d/o JOHN and MARY HOLTZCLAW McCRAVY. Member of Montgomery Memorial Methodist church, Pacolet Mills. Surviving are 3 sisters, MRS. SARA LAMB, Whitney, MRS. MARY KITCHENS, Roebuck and MRS. NELLIE SUMNER, Fort Mills. Funeral services at the church, burial was in the White Rose cemetery. The family is at Beaumont at the home of MARK McCRAVY. Floyd Mortuary in charge. ----- Pauline, May 19- MRS. BESSIE GRANT CROWE, 68, died at the home of her daughter, MRS. VIRGINIA SMITH of Pauline, after a brief illness. Lanford- Boyter Mortuary in charge. ----- Landrum, May 19- MRS. ELEANOR PIERCE BARNETT, 60, died at her home after several months of declining health. MRS. BARNETT was born and reared in the Oak Grove section near Landrum and was the d/o MARTHA GOSNELL PIERCE and the late DAVID PIERCE. Surviving are one brother, JAMES LEWIS PIERCE, Asheville; 2 sisters, MRS. HENRY FISHER, Hickory and MRS. HESTER FISHER, Campobello. Funeral services were conducted at Oak Grove Bapt. church, burial in church cemetery. Pallbearers; HERBERT LISTER, FURMAN BULL, J.C.
